arduino電子藝術--pwm直流電機電調實驗
相信愛上
arduino
會讓你變成電子藝術家
-----
einyboy or alert
2012-12-15
日早上,忙裡偷閒做了「
pwm直流電機控制實驗」這個實驗。
pwm電調算是一種比較低階的自動控制技術,所謂的低階就是精度,跟態度恨不能無法調整。更高階的自動控制技術要用到
pid了。本人非電專業,在大學時自覺完成「訊號與系統」,「自動控制」這兩們課程,下乙個電機實驗終於可以用上
pid這些自動控制的東西了。
一、電子裝備
arduino uno板1
塊l298
雙橋驅動版1塊
導線若干
直流減速電機1個
一、電路連線說明
l298n out1
,out2
分別直接電機引用
l298n n1,n2
分別接arduino 10,11
引腳l298n ena
使能端接
arduino 6
引腳,高電平有效
l298n +5v
腳接arduino +5v
l298n gnd
腳接arduino gnd
一、實驗功能點
1.電機停止,正轉,反轉
2.pwm
調速**:
一、後續改進
1.通過比例-積分
-微分pid控制器進行精確自動調整
2.通過藍芽控制電機轉動。
Arduino實現PWM 調控燈光亮度
arduino 控制器有6 個pwm 介面分別是數字介面3 5 6 9 10 11,前面我們已經做了按鍵控制小燈的實驗,那是數碼訊號控制数字介面的實驗,我們也做過電位計的實驗,這次我們就來完成乙個用電位計控制小燈的實驗。需要的元器件有 電位計模組 1 紅色m5 直插led 1 220 直插電阻 麵包...
Arduino系列之pwm控制LED燈(呼吸燈)
下面我將寫出最簡單控制呼吸燈的方法 void setup pinmode 12,output 設定12號引腳為輸出引腳 void loop 進入迴圈 for int a 0 a 255 a 當a 0並且a小於255時候,a自加 analogwrite 12,a 12號引腳為pwm腳,輸出亮度 del...
使用arduino輸出PWM波控制模型車
本文是學習極客學院上由troy wei老師提供的 玩轉arduino 周邊模組 執行部件 課程筆記 arduino 帶 的引腳可以輸出pwm波 使用analogwrite庫函式analogwrite pin,valuevalue範圍在0 255 為什麼6個埠可以輸出pwm波,三個定時器,乙個定時器可...